Cruising sober

Hello! Newbie here. 12 days sober from alcohol. I have a 4-day cruise coming up at the end of Feb. This will be my first alcohol-free cruise. I’m very nervous I’m going to fail the moment I step into that environment. I’m trying to stay positive and plan ahead (exercise in the AM, meditation, etc). Luckily one of the ladies I’m going with is pregnant, so she won’t be drinking, but the other girl is a bit of a heavy drinker. Any tips or advice for when those cravings and FOMO hit hard? The thought of waking up with no hangover is a huge motivator, but we all know how our brain gets when we’re in the middle of those bad cravings and peer pressure. Thanks for listening and any advice is much appreciated!

They have meetings on most cruises. Look for Friends of Bill W in the program schedule.

Yes, they have meetings and you’ll hook up with other sober folks. They are 12 step meetings for AA, Alanon, OA, and NA all together. I bought myself a beverage card so I could drink all the specialty coffee I wanted. That was all the treat I needed.
I spent time in the spa area which was very quiet and soothing. You do YOU. Don’t worry about your drinking friend. She’ll meet people to drink with, and you’ll wake up refreshed every morning ready for another lovely day of adventure. AND remember the day before without quilt or shame. :unicorn:
